How to fill out the Mifa Provident Fund Claim Forms online

Filling out the Mifa Provident Fund Claim Forms online can streamline your claims process and ensure that all necessary information is submitted correctly. This guide will provide you with step-by-step instructions to help you complete the form accurately and efficiently.

Follow the steps to fill out the Mifa Provident Fund Claim Forms online

  1. Press the ‘Get Form’ button to access the form and open it for completion.
  2. Begin by entering the year of assessment for which you are requesting a tax deduction directive in the appropriate fields.
  3. Provide your particulars including surname, first names, date of birth, and identity number. If you have other identification, specify those details as well.
  4. Indicate whether you are registered for income tax. If not, select the appropriate reason from the options provided.
  5. Fill in your residential address and postal address along with the respective postal codes.
  6. For the particulars of the fund, enter the name of the fund, contact person's name, telephone number, fund approval number, and the PAYE reference number.
  7. Specify your membership number and type of fund—either provident, pension, or another category—as required.
  8. Provide particulars of the gross lump sum due and select the reason for the directive such as resignation, winding up, or unclaimed benefit.
  9. Enter the gross amount of the lump sum payment and the date on which it accrued.
  10. If applicable, complete any fields relevant to periods of membership and employment, particularly for public sector funds.
  11. Review all sections to ensure accuracy and completeness.
  12. Once everything is correctly filled out, you can save changes, download, print, or share the completed form as needed.
